How does Seagull capture Chinese audio without plugins?

Seagull accesses system audio directly at the operating system level on Mac, Windows, and Linux. It does not require any browser extensions, app plugins, or third-party software. Once launched, it listens to your desktop and translates any audio it detects.

What latency should I expect for Chinese to Norwegian translation?

Most phrases translate with a latency of 2 to 5 seconds, depending on audio clarity and phrase length. The longer the Chinese phrase, the slightly longer the translation takes to appear as a Norwegian subtitle. Real-time translation is fast enough for live calls, but not instantaneous like human simultaneous interpretation.
